yum命令安装nginx。 在此期间,我写了一篇使用安装包编译并安装nginx的文章。 过程很多,比较复杂。 使用安装包编译和安装需要安装nginx所需的环境,所以今天我们将分享使用yum进行安装的方法。 这很简单。
1、首先安装yum-utils yum-utils是管理repository和扩展包的工具。 主要针对储存库。
执行命令:
yum install yum-utils
2、添加nginx源文件nginx.repo repo文件是Fedora的yum源(软件仓库)的配置文件,通常,一个repo文件定义一个或多个软件仓库的详细内容。 例如,从哪里下载需要安装或升级的包,repo文件的设置将读取并应用于yum。
1、进入文件夹:
cd /etc/yum.repos.d/
2、新建并编辑文件:
vim nginx.repo
3、输入并保存以下内容: (备注: releasever )这表示当前系统的发行版,basearch是我们的系统硬件架构(CPU指令集),系统本身就是这样配置的,系统本身去读取服务器的配置,对应
[ nginx-stable ] name=nginxstablerepobaseurl=http://nginx.org/packages/centos/$ releasever/$ basearch/gpg check name=nginxmainlinerepobaseurl=http://nginx.org/packages/mainline/centos gpg check=1enabled=0gpg key=33https://nginx .
yum search nginx
3、安装nginx 1,运行命令安装nginx :
yum install nginx
2、运行命令验证安装的nginx软件包名称:
rpm -qa | grep nginx
3、启动nginx :
systemctl start nginx
4:查看nginx的状态:
systemctl status nginx
5:nginx重新启动
系统重新开始nginx
yum安装的nginx配置文件的缺省值为/etc/nginx/conf.d/default.conf。
静态文件的html目录是/usr/share/nginx/html/
这个用yum安装nginx就完成了。 特别简单,不是比安装包简单得多吗?
yum安装的优点是快速、简单,不需要自己解决依赖和环境问题,系统就可以一起安装。 但是存在定制性不强的缺点,需要更多的模块时,使用源代码进行编译安装。